Schaeffler India Limited is the larger company by market capitalisation. Amara Raja Energy & Mobility Limited shows a lower P/E, while Schaeffler India Limited shows a higher ROE, a higher dividend yield and faster revenue growth. These are relative readings on individual metrics — weigh valuation against growth, margins, leverage and capital efficiency rather than treating any single number as decisive.

How to Read This Comparison

Valuation ratios (P/E, P/B) use the latest consolidated figures where available; growth numbers compare against the same period last year; shareholding percentages come from the most recent quarterly filings, with the change shown against the prior quarter. A "more favourable" highlight is relative between these two companies only — it is not a rating, a recommendation, or a comparison against the wider sector. Rows with no reported data for either company are hidden rather than shown empty.
